Materials That Power Modern Industry
Plastics are essential to South Korea's manufacturing economy, providing lightweight, durable, and versatile materials for electronics, automobiles, packaging, construction, and consumer goods. The country's plastics industry is closely tied to its world-class petrochemical sector, giving manufacturers access to high-quality raw materials and strong research capabilities. As a result, Korean producers have moved increasingly toward high-performance engineering plastics and specialty polymers.
This evolution reflects the demands of advanced industries that require materials with precise mechanical, thermal, and electrical properties. Rather than competing solely on commodity resins, Korean firms increasingly differentiate through engineered materials and sustainable solutions. The manufacturers below represent the breadth of Korea's plastics sector, from large integrated producers to specialty material innovators.
The Leading Plastic Manufacturers
1. LG Chem is a dominant force in polymers and engineering plastics, supplying high-performance materials for electronics, automotive, and industrial applications worldwide.
2. Lotte Chemical produces a wide range of plastics and polyolefins, with growing investment in specialty and sustainable materials that meet evolving regulations.
3. Hanwha Solutions manufactures PVC, polyethylene, and advanced plastic materials used across construction and industrial sectors.
4. Kumho Petrochemical supplies engineering plastics and synthetic materials valued for durability and consistent performance.
5. SK Chemicals is a leader in eco-friendly plastics and bioplastics, emphasizing sustainable, recyclable materials for packaging and consumer goods.
6. Hyosung Chemical produces polypropylene and specialty plastic products serving diverse manufacturing needs with reliable supply.
7. Korea Petrochemical (KPIC) manufactures polyolefins and basic plastic resins for a broad customer base across industries.
8. Kolon Plastics specializes in engineering plastics such as polyoxymethylene, used in precision automotive and industrial components.
9. Samyang Corporation offers engineering plastics and specialty materials for electronics and consumer applications.

Industry Trends and Innovation
Engineering and high-performance plastics are the key growth area. Industries such as automotive and electronics increasingly rely on advanced polymers that offer strength, heat resistance, and light weight to improve efficiency and performance. Korean producers are investing heavily in these higher-value materials to capture growing demand.
Sustainability is reshaping the industry. Mounting concern over plastic waste has driven significant investment in recycled plastics, bioplastics, and chemical recycling technologies. Several Korean companies are developing materials with reduced environmental impact and improved recyclability, responding to both regulation and customer demand for greener solutions.
Lightweighting in mobility is another important trend. As automakers pursue greater fuel efficiency and electric-vehicle range, demand grows for plastics that can replace heavier materials while maintaining safety and durability. Korean producers are well positioned to serve this need thanks to their advanced materials expertise.

Market Outlook
The outlook for Korean plastics centers on high-performance materials and sustainability. Demand for engineering plastics is expected to rise as automotive and electronics customers seek lighter, stronger, and more heat-resistant materials. Electric vehicles in particular will drive demand for advanced polymers that reduce weight and improve range. At the same time, regulation and consumer pressure are accelerating the shift toward recycled content, bioplastics, and chemical recycling. Korean producers that combine integrated petrochemical strength with leadership in specialty and sustainable materials are well positioned to grow. Investment in research and cleaner production will increasingly separate market leaders from commodity-focused competitors.
